THE NEWCASTLE KITCHEN FITTER / DESIGNER MARKET

What's actually happening here.

Newcastle's kitchen market is anchored by three distinct premium tiers. Ponteland, Darras Hall, Stocksfield, Corbridge and the NE20 / NE43 / NE45 corridor support a sustained £30,000–£80,000 bespoke joinery market for high-net-worth Newcastle professionals doing barn conversions, Northumberland-stone-cottage extensions, Georgian rectory renovations and contemporary new-build estate housing. Darras Hall in particular is one of the highest-value private-housing estates in northern England, regularly supplying £40k+ kitchen specification for premier-league footballer and senior-corporate clientele. Jesmond, Gosforth, Heaton, Sandyford, Fenham and the NE2 / NE3 corridor support £18,000–£35,000 mid-premium specification for early-family professional homeowners and academic-professional households (Newcastle University catchment). Tynemouth, Whitley Bay, Cullercoats and the NE26 / NE30 coastal belt support £20,000–£40,000 coastal-property specification.

Newcastle Quayside, Ouseburn and the city-centre apartment market pulls £15,000–£30,000 contemporary handleless work for young-professional homeowners. Newcastle-wide Google Ads CPCs for 'kitchen designer Newcastle' run £2.50–£7 in 2024–2025, with significantly lower CPCs (£1–£2.50 for 'kitchen fitter Byker', 'kitchen fitter Walker', 'kitchen fitter Benwell'). Howdens runs 14+ North East depots — Newcastle (multiple), Gateshead, Sunderland, North Shields, South Shields, Cramlington, Blyth, Morpeth, Hexham, Durham — supplying the dominant £10,000–£20,000 install band where Wickes installed-kitchens and Wren's Team Valley / Silverlink showrooms provide the volume competition.

How do you handle the Northumberland-stone-cottage / Georgian-rectory bespoke market in Stocksfield, Corbridge and Hexham?

The Northumberland commuter belt — Stocksfield, Corbridge, Hexham, Riding Mill, Wylam — supports £30–60k bespoke joinery for high-net-worth Newcastle commuters doing Northumberland-stone-cottage refurbishments, Georgian rectory renovations and barn conversions. Many properties are listed buildings or in conservation areas requiring Northumberland County Council planning officer engagement.
